DESCRIPTION:Give the gift of western New York! Western New York An Explorer's Guide From Niagara Falls and Southern Ontario to the Western Edge of the Finger Lakes by Christine A. Smyczynski\, the only comprehensive travel guidebook to the region\, makes the perfect holiday gift for the person who has everything. The book\, written for locals as well as tourists\, is truly one size fits all! As you can see\, the possibilities are endless. If you'd like a signed copy of the book\, author Christine Smyczynski will be at the following locations: Sunday November 18 \, 11am-4pm\, Hobart and William Smith College Book and Craft Fair\, Hobart and William Smith College\, Bristol Field House\, Hamilton Street\, Geneva. (315) 781-3449. This annual event is free and open to the public. Here you'll find independent booksellers\, authors/illustrators/photographers\, crafters and artists. There will be children's activities\, live music\, food and more. Sunday December 2\, 1-3pm\, at the "Shopstravaganza" holiday shopping event at the Buffalo and Erie County Historical Society\, 25 Nottingham Court\, Buffalo (716-873-9644). This annual event will feature over two dozen local authors\, as well as western New York related merchandise from the museum shop. Friday December 14\, 2-4pm\, Borders Express\, Boulevard Mall\, Amherst. The book\, which retails for $19.95\, is available at bookstores\, specialty retailers\, museum shops and online at www.countrymanpress.com\, www.buffalobooks.com and www.amazon.com. For more information about the book\, visit http://explorewny.home.att.net  The author writes travel articles for numerous publications\, including The Buffalo News\, Western New York Family\, Buffalo Spree\, Rochester Magazine and the Democrat & Chronicle.
